## Step 4: Pin dependencies before cutting a release

All Quillfort services pin exact versions in lockfiles; ranges are forbidden in production manifests. When bumping a dependency, update the lockfile in a dedicated commit so the diff is auditable. Transitive overrides go in the `constraints.toml` file, never inline. The release bot refuses to build if any unpinned spec is detected. After pinning, verify the build against the Harlow staging mirror, then sign the manifest. Use the key shown below for all manifest signatures.

signing key of bagap-yawep = bky13_TbfT6ZMUoGJo2

## Deployment

Snapshot testing for the Lumenfall UI component library runs in a sandboxed renderer before any deploy is promoted. Each snapshot diff is hashed and compared against the approved baseline stored in the Verdant artifact vault; mismatches block the pipeline until a reviewer signs off. No snapshot artifacts leave the build network, and retention is capped at thirty days. The renderer reads its settings at startup, so verify the values below match the hardened profile.

config for kafof-bawef:
holath:
  log_level: debug
  metrics_host: metrics.holath.qorvelsys.internal
  pin: 2191
  pool_size: 32

Internal Memo — Office Closure

Team, quick heads-up: we're closing the small Ferndale Row office at Merrow Point by end of quarter. Only six desks affected; staff move to the Ashgrove hub. Finance, please wind down the lease accruals and flag any exit penalties. Context on why sits in the note below.

confidential, kagap-yagef: The finance team signed off on a budget of $467.8 million for Project Aldok.